LeBron James On If He’ll Play In The Olympics This Summer: “I Think I’m Going To Play For The Toon Squad This Summer Instead Of The Olympics…”

LeBron James finished the 2020/21 NBA season with a defeat against the Phoenix Suns in the first round of the playoffs. After a short turnaround of the season, the King rested for about two months before going back to competition with the purple and gold. 

LBJ suffered a couple of injuries during the season, and it’s time to get some rest and prepare for the next campaign. That is why he’s pulling out of the 2021 Team USA in the upcoming Summer Olympics. 

Finishing his post-game interview, Bron revealed his plans for the summer. Instead of going to Tokyo, he will play in another big match with the Toon Squad (11:08).

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=aOdqwpZkXTM

“Na, I think I’m gonna play for the Tune Squad this summer instead of the Olympics.

“I think that’s what my focus is on, on trying to beat the Monstars – or the Goon Squad we call them now.

“So didn’t have much success versus the Suns, so now I am gearing my attention to the Goon Squad here in July, in mid-July. So I’m gonna let the ankle rest for about a month and then I’m going to gear up with Lola, Taz, Granny, Bugs and the rest of the crew. So hopefully I’ll see y’all at the match.”

After a season full of ups and downs with the Lakers, it’s time to relax and get ready for the next term. Still, Bron’s team needs to make some moves in the offseason if they intend to go back to the top of the league next year. 

As for now, he will focus on beating the Goon Squad and save his son from Don Cheadle in the new Space Jam movie, set to premiere next July.
